Scanner why not? They produce perfectly clear pictures for posting purposes, excepting the lack of ability to show luster. Keep the sensitivity to 600dpi or less for posting whole-coin pics; 300dpi will do. Remember, very few of us are looking at these pics with a monitor which will show more than 100dpi. That keeps file size down. A clear scan of a coin which is 650 pixels in diameter is enough to come up with a tentative grade and firm attribution of a Bust Half.
